What Is a Fractional CFO?
A fractional CFO is a seasoned financial executive who works part-time or on a project basis. Unlike a full-time CFO, they bring specialized expertise without the overhead costs. Here’s why hiring one can be a game-changer:
1. Cost Efficiency
Fractional CFOs offer cost-effective solutions. Instead of a hefty annual salary, you pay for their services based on your needs—whether it’s a few hours a week or specific projects. This flexibility allows you to allocate resources wisely.
2. Strategic Insights
A fractional CFO brings fresh perspectives. They analyze financial data, identify trends, and provide actionable insights. Whether it’s optimizing pricing strategies or streamlining operations, their strategic guidance can drive growth.
3. Scalability
As your company grows, so do its financial complexities. A fractional CFO scales with you. They adapt to changing demands, from fundraising to mergers and acquisitions. Their expertise ensures smooth transitions during critical phases.
4. Customized Solutions
No two companies are alike. A fractional CFO tailors solutions to your unique challenges. Whether it’s restructuring debt, improving profitability, or enhancing financial controls, their customized approach aligns with your goals.
5. Risk Mitigation
Financial risks abound—from compliance to cybersecurity threats. A fractional CFO assesses risks, implements safeguards, and ensures regulatory compliance. Their vigilance protects your company’s reputation and stability.
Maximizing Impact: Steps to Success
To harness the full potential of a fractional CFO, follow these steps:
1. Define Objectives
Clarify your goals. Are you aiming for rapid expansion, turnaround, or sustainable growth? Communicate your vision to your fractional CFO—they’ll align their efforts accordingly.
2. Collaborate Closely
Treat your fractional CFO as a strategic partner. Involve them in key decisions, from budgeting to investment choices. Their insights can shape your financial roadmap.
3. Leverage Technology
Fractional CFOs leverage technology for efficiency. Implement robust financial systems, automate processes, and use data analytics to drive informed decisions.
4. Communicate Transparently
Share critical information openly. Fractional CFOs need context to provide effective solutions. Transparency fosters trust and ensures accurate financial reporting.
5. Measure Impact
Set clear performance metrics. Regularly evaluate the impact of your fractional CFO’s contributions. Are margins improving? Is cash flow optimized? Adjust strategies as needed.
